Wall Cracks and Bulges



The existence of wall splits and protrudes is a common indicator of potential structure concerns in a building (Foundation Repair Dallas). These indicators should not be ignored, as they can signify structural troubles that may require instant attention. Wall surface fractures can appear in different types, such as horizontal, vertical, or diagonal lines, and their dimension and width can vary. Bulges, on the other hand, happen when the wall surface sticks out outward, showing that the structure is moving or resolving unevenly.


When wall cracks and bulges are observed, it is essential to evaluate the severity of the problem and figure out the underlying reason. In many cases, minor cracks can be an outcome of normal settling over time and may not require immediate intervention. Nonetheless, if the cracks are larger than a quarter-inch or remain to expand, it is recommended to speak with a specialist engineer or structure professional to carry out a complete examination.


Repairing wall surface splits and bulges will certainly depend on the intensity of the foundation concern. For small fractures, loading them with epoxy or sealant can help stop additional damage. If the splits are an outcome of substantial structure troubles, much more substantial repair work may be necessary, such as foundation or installing steel braces to stabilize the foundation.


Uneven or Sloping Floorings



Irregular or sloping floorings can typically be an obvious sign of structure concerns, frequently showing structural problems that require instant focus. When a foundation moves or resolves, it can cause the floors to come to be unlevel, leading to a range of issues throughout the structure. One of the main reasons for unequal floors is a compromised foundation, such as a sinking or moving foundation. This can take place because of soil movement, insufficient drain, or inadequate building and construction practices. As the structure steps, it can create the floors to tilt or incline, resulting in noticeable adjustments in the floor's height or incline from one area to another.


It is essential to address sloping or unequal floorings without delay, as failing to do so can cause additional damage and a lot more substantial and pricey fixings down the line. To fix this problem, it is necessary to determine the underlying cause of the foundation trouble and address it accordingly. This might entail addressing drain problems, supporting the structure, and even underpinning the influenced areas.


Consulting with review an expert structure repair service specialist is very recommended to accurately identify the reason for the uneven floors and establish an effective repair plan. They will analyze the level of the damages, establish the best program of action, and guarantee that the repair services are executed correctly to recover the stability and levelness of the floorings. By promptly resolving uneven or sloping floorings, you can secure the architectural stability of the building and keep its value.

Doors and Windows Sticking



One usual issue that can emerge from foundation issues is doors and windows sticking. When the structure of a building shifts or clears up, it can trigger the door structures and window frameworks to become misaligned.


Sticking windows and doors can be even more than just a hassle; they can additionally signify underlying foundation problems. These structure troubles can lead to further damage to the structure of the structure if left neglected. For that reason, it is essential to deal with sticking home windows and doors as soon as they are discovered.


To fix sticking home windows and doors, it is essential to deal with the underlying structure trouble. This may involve employing an expert structure repair service specialist who can analyze the level of the damages and suggest the suitable strategy. Depending upon the severity of the foundation concern, fixings might include approaches such as slabjacking, underpinning, or piering to see page maintain and level the structure.

One more sign of structure concerns is the visibility of recognizable voids in between windows/doors and wall surfaces. These spaces can take place when the structure shifts or clears up, triggering the walls to divide from the doors or home windows. As the structure actions, it can develop unequal pressure on the structure, resulting in voids and splits in the walls.


Voids between windows/doors and walls can vary in size and seriousness. In many cases, the voids may be small and hardly recognizable, while in others, they can be wide adequate to permit drafts, water, or bugs to go into the structure. FCS Foundation Repair Dallas Concrete Contractor. These gaps can likewise impact the capability of doors and home windows, triggering them to stick or not shut effectively


Fixing voids between wall surfaces and windows/doors requires attending to the underlying foundation problems. This normally includes supporting the foundation by utilizing techniques such as underpinning or foundation piers. These methods aid to degree and sustain the foundation, reducing the activity that leads to spaces. Once the structure is maintained, the gaps can be repaired by loading them with an appropriate sealer or by re-installing the home windows or doors. It is essential to speak with an expert foundation repair professional to precisely assess the reason for the gaps and identify one of the most reliable repair service remedy.


Water Damage or Basement Leaks



When foundation concerns are existing, one usual indicator to look out for is water damages or cellar leakages. Water damages can be a clear indicator that there are problems with the foundation of a building.


To repair water damages or cellar leaks, it is necessary to address the underlying foundation problems. FCS Foundation Repair Dallas. This may include fixing cracks or spaces in the structure, boosting drainage systems around the building, or setting up a sump pump to avoid water build-up in the cellar. It is vital to speak with a professional structure fixing specialist to accurately diagnose the reason of the water damages or leakages and establish one of the most proper repair work technique
